Enhanced solutions for seamless SAP transformation in the metals industry
Berlin, October 21, 2025 – PSI Software SE and Metals Experience GmbH (metalsXP), a leading SAP consulting company specialized in the metals and mining industry, have entered a partnership. This will provide mutual customers with access to seamless SAP transformation processes and industry-specific consulting services, as well as integrated software solutions with only a single point of contact for complex digitalization projects.

As SAP is the most widely used ERP system (Enterprise Resource Planning) in the metals industry, such transformations help simplify system architectures and optimize both business processes and digital landscapes. The collaboration combines PSI’s robust, industry-proven production management systems with metalsXP’s deep metallurgical expertise and specialized tools for ERP. Together, this will enable metals producers to seamlessly integrate Production Execution Systems with ERP, driving greater transparency, efficiency, and operational excellence.

metalsXP is the leading international pioneer in digitalization in the metals and mining industry. With offices in Germany, Austria, Slovakia, and the Czech Republic, the company delivers results-driven, end-to-end SAP solutions for optimizing processes from specification to certificate, from customer to payment, and supply chain execution.
The PSI Group develops software products for optimizing the flow of energy and materials for utilities and industry. As an independent software producer with more than 2,300 employees, PSI has been a technology leader since 1969 for process control systems that ensure sustainable energy supply, mobility and production by combining AI methods with industrially proven optimization methods. The innovative industry products can be operated on-premises or in the cloud.
